United States - Pelagic Fish Protein Supply Quantity Per Capita
Since 2014, United States Pelagic Fish Protein Supply Quantity Per Capita decreased by 2.8% year on year. At 0.99 Grams Per Capita Per Day in 2019, the country was number 103 among other countries in Pelagic Fish Protein Supply Quantity Per Capita. Maldives ranked the highest with 26.19 Grams Per Capita Per Day in 2019, that is a fall of 1.2% compared to 2018. Kiribati, Iceland and Samoa resp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guinea-Bissau recorded the best 5 years average growth at +20.1% per year, while Nepal was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
